3Introduction
This installation note describes how to install the wall mount bracket, transformer input panel,
and crossover input panel used with the EVID-S and LB20 dual 10" subwoofers. The
accessories are available in black or white.
These products are compatible with the following products:
CTNDescription
EVID-S10.1DBCabinet subwoofer 2x10" black
EVID-S10.1DWCabinet subwoofer 2x10" white
LB20-SW400-DCabinet subwoofer 2x10" black
LB20-SW400-LCabinet subwoofer 2x10" white

4Installation
For safety, ensure the mounting surface supports more than the weight of the speaker. Use
only industry-accepted fasteners and mounting methods when mounting the loudspeaker.
Consult an expert if you are unsure.

Safety point
As an added safety measure, it is suggested the user install an extra suspension point back to
the building structural supports. This safety point should have as little slack as possible (less
than 1-inch is preferable).
4.1Installing the U-bracket
To install the U-bracket, do the following:
1.Install the four screws (provided) into the U-bracket mounting points.
2.Install a 10-mm rated forged eyebolt (not included) into the safety point.
3.Secure the subwoofer from the safety eyebolt using a rated fittings and steel cable.
Suspending the subwoofer in a down-fire position using the U-bracket
To suspend the subwoofer in a horizontal down-fire position, do the following:
1.Install two 10-mm rated forged eyebolts using lock washers (eyebolts and lock washers
are not included) into the fly points on the U-bracket.
2.Install a 10-mm rated forged eyebolt (not included) into the safety point.
3.Suspend the subwoofer from the eyebolts using rated fittings and steel cable.
4.Secure the subwoofer from the safety eyebolt using a rated fittings and steel cable.
